This use case introduces you to the key requirements of General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R) and how you can address them using the Talend products.

The critical aspect of GDPR is that it impacts the collection and use of personal data. GDPR compliance requires any organization controlling or processing personal data of EU residents to have a solution that allows them to demonstrate that personal data is being captured, processed, and protected in a controlled, lawful, and fair manner. They also need to ensure that data is appropriately anonymized, retained, and shared transparently with the data subjects and deleted when asked to do so.

 

Complying with GDPR requires companies around the world to have a clear data governance plan.

 

Talend provides an end-to-end solution that meets these requirements. Talend can accelerate the build of a data warehouse to address the data storage, retention, and security requirements that are mandated by GDPR:

  • Talend Data Integration: data capture and integration

  • Talend Data Catalog: data mapping and lineage

  • Talend Data Services: data portability

  • Talend Data Quality: data anonymization

  • Talend Data Preparation: self-service curation
